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Canarian Shrew | Orange Featherleg |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Animals)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um | Chordata (Chordates) | Arthropoda (Arthropods) |
| Class | Mammalia (Mammals) | Insecta (Insects) |
| Order | Soricomorpha (Soricomorpha) | Odonata (Odonata) |
| Family | Soricidae | Platycnemididae |
| Genus | Crocidura | Platycnemis |
| Species | Crocidura canariensis | Platycnemis acutipennis |
